Software Engineering Specialist Job Description

Software Engineering Specialist Job Description

4.5
176 votes for Software Engineering Specialist
Software engineering specialist provides technical expertise of various Network technologies including but not limited to DNS, DHCP, IP address Management, Load Balancing and Network Security products.

Software Engineering Specialist Duties & Responsibilities

To write an effective software engineering specialist job description, begin by listing detailed duties, responsibilities and expectations. We have included software engineering specialist job description templates that you can modify and use.

Sample responsibilities for this position include:

You'll have the chance to develop your Java technical skills by sharing knowledge with the most professional JAVA developers
You will have the chance to improve your JAVA professional skills by sharing knowledge with the best Java developers
You will have Design and Development of large scale, distributed systems using Java/JEE technologies
You will develop a maintainable, scalable and supportable code in Java language
You will design, build, and maintain efficient, reusable, and reliable Java code, low-latency applications for mission-critical systems, delivering high-availability and performance
You will Work as Java Specialist, and perform complex research and new technology learning tasks
You will develop Java in and on top the product
Understand, explain coherently, guide on all software development practices such as refactoring, unit testing
Responsible for development and maintenance of MyOrders application & interfaces
Investigation - Investigates issues by reviewing/debugging code and providing fixes (analyzes and fixes bugs) and workarounds, reviews changes for operability to maintain existing software solutions

Software Engineering Specialist Qualifications

Qualifications for a job description may include education, certification, and experience.

Licensing or Certifications for Software Engineering Specialist

List any licenses or certifications required by the position: JSP, RPA, JAVA, UNIX, SQL, ITIL, UI, SFDC, ISTQB, CSQA

Education for Software Engineering Specialist

Typically a job would require a certain level of education.

Employers hiring for the software engineering specialist job most commonly would prefer for their future employee to have a relevant degree such as Bachelor's and Master's Degree in Science, Computer Science, Engineering, Technology, Math, Computing, Technical, Information Systems, Computer, Software Engineering

Skills for Software Engineering Specialist

Desired skills for software engineering specialist include:

Product/solution and technologies to influence the direction and evolution of the product/solution
Design patterns
Virtualization
Distributed systems
Load balancing
Software and network security
Java
Linux kernel
Network protocols
Object Oriented Design and development

Desired experience for software engineering specialist includes:

Team Work and Collaboration - Collaborates and adds value through participation in peer code reviews, provides comments and suggestions, and works with cross-functional teams to achieve goals
Technical Ownership - Assumes ownership and accountability of specific modules within an application and provides technical support and guidance during solution design for new requirements, problem resolution for critical / complex issues
Quality and SLAs - Contributes to meet various SLAs and KPIs as applicable for account and unit - for example, Responsiveness, Resolution, Software Quality SLAs
Must be willing to work out of an office located in Shanghai, China
BSc in Computer Science or related discipline or equivalent professional qualification2 year’s related experience in engineering
Minimum 2 years in Senior QA Engineer designation and role with minimum1 Year in a QA Lead Role

Software Engineering Specialist Examples

1

Software Engineering Specialist Job Description

Job Description Example
Our growing company is searching for experienced candidates for the position of software engineering specialist.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for software engineering specialist
  • You will have the chance to work in an international environment
  • You will take part of developing NFV platform
  • You will Be part of a new business unit that establishing to provide cutting edge product for the telecom industry, and help us go where no person has gone before
  • You will exposed to other amazing employees and intelligent thinkers
  • You will be accountable for software development and/or maintenance
  • You will participate in developing software used by millions of users
  • You will show professionalism and maturity as technical expert
  • You will lead complex designs
  • You will work with Architects/Experts to define product technical vision and ensure its conveyed to team
  • You will be the take part in teams Agile ceremonies (planning , sprints, team backlog, team sprint readiness)
Qualifications for software engineering specialist
  • Minimum 1 year experience in mobile app testing and test automation
  • Good knowledge and experience in practicing Agile/Scrum
  • A young team
  • XML tools (e
  • Microsoft Office (Excel, Word, Visio)
  • Experience with responsive design and grid frameworks (Bootstrap, Foundation, ), including cross-browser compatibility
2

Software Engineering Specialist Job Description

Job Description Example
Our company is growing rapidly and is looking for a software engineering specialist. We appreciate you taking the time to review the list of qualifications and to apply for the position. If you don’t fill all of the qualifications, you may still be considered depending on your level of experience.
Responsibilities for software engineering specialist
  • You will work with product management on scope, priority
  • You will have cross teams & project responsibilities
  • You will meet aggressive release milestones
  • You will continuously seeking and implementing improvements from various angles - technically, quality, processes, socially
  • You will part of team of 5-7 Developers
  • You will have the ability to effectively prioritize and execute tasks in a high pressure environment
  • You will have the opportunity to work in a growing business group, with ever growing opportunities for personal growth
  • You will work with great people who care and love their job
  • You will design cloud architecture in NFV service provider environment
  • You will gather technical information, specifications and systems level architecture from customers
Qualifications for software engineering specialist
  • You will Work with early stage customer prospects, understanding their solutions requirements, help them develop their solutions with the criteria under which the solution will optimally within their environment
  • Platform Architecture -- participants will have the opportunity to learn about the role of our platform architects
  • Data Analytics --- participants will have the opportunity to learn database engineering concepts for a number of types of data storage technologies including relational databases, noSQL databases and "Big Data" solutions
  • Understanding of basic software/computer science engineering concepts
  • Identify potential production issues with each and every delivery and take corrective actions
  • Work with the set configuration related process and procedures
3

Software Engineering Specialist Job Description

Job Description Example
Our company is growing rapidly and is searching for experienced candidates for the position of software engineering specialist. Please review the list of responsibilities and qualifications. While this is our ideal list, we will consider candidates that do not necessarily have all of the qualifications, but have sufficient experience and talent.
Responsibilities for software engineering specialist
  • You will develop and deliver Demos and Proof of concepts based on customer requirements
  • You will analyze new technologies, integrate with new 3rd parties and customer existing systems
  • You will implementat with high coding standards, and awareness of quality-driven development including unit testing and component testing
  • Understands core data structures and algorithms and has the ability to implement them using language of choice
  • Is open to receiving guidance and direction
  • Development of the OMS upgrade to version v9.1 from OMS v6 following the Agile and DevOps methodologies
  • Mentoring colleagues and reviewing code
  • Participating in and leading software design sessions with the customer and within the team
  • Contributing to documentation such as release notes, impact assessments, detailed design
  • Investigate and resolve defects participate in and/or lead CR reviews in order to analyze and understand the business requirements, and provide solutions
Qualifications for software engineering specialist
  • Familiarity with Industrial protocols like Modbus, EGD, OPC and other IOT protocols
  • With a customer base of 8.1 million, TELUS is one of the largest telecom companies in Canada and is the #1 leader in customer satisfaction, loyalty surveys of Canadian telecommunication service providers (wireless & wireline), and has the lowest churn percentage (wireless) in North America
  • TELUS is one of the few companies in the telecom sector in the world that's delivering growth quarter after quarter in both the wireless & wireline markets
  • Setting long term commercial strategic direction for assigned categories including Engineering and Manufacturing Equipment and Engineering Tools
  • Perform integration and deployment of complex COTS vendor applications in distributed, highly available environments
  • Design, develop, and maintain Web Service integrations using Vendor provided API/SDKs
4

Software Engineering Specialist Job Description

Job Description Example
Our growing company is looking for a software engineering specialist. If you are looking for an exciting place to work, please take a look at the list of qualifications below.
Responsibilities for software engineering specialist
  • You will maintain the Master Enterprise Catalog product (MEC) and to provide high quality development services on top and around the product to empower the MEC business
  • You will Be a trust advisor for MEC accounts
  • You will be Involve in POC and presales activities (onsite and remote)
  • You will Take part with the development of the next generation product
  • Applies specialized knowledge of engineering principles and practices to assigned tasks to develop and support activities in the area of electrical & electronics engineering
  • Verifying and validating controls, hardware, or software
  • Design and Analysis of Electric Generators/Alternators and motors, Electrical Circuit Design, Performance simulation of Electrical Power Systems
  • Diagnostics and OBD
  • Implementation of new version in to production related to above products and work closely with the customer on various issues
  • Handling of business requests in the form of Intake form/Remedy tickets
Qualifications for software engineering specialist
  • Must be willing to work out of an office located in San Ramon, CA, Redmond, WA or Boston, MA
  • Demonstrated experience configuring, integrating, deploying, and troubleshooting COTS vendor applications
  • 5+ years experience with SQL coding and database systems such as SQL Server (MongoDB and Oracle a plus)
  • 5+ years experience with VB.Net framework 4.5 and C#
  • Performs all aspects of the Software Development Lifecycle, including requirements analysis, design, implementation, unit testing, system testing
  • You will serve as an expert on Ensemble billing system
5

Software Engineering Specialist Job Description

Job Description Example
Our innovative and growing company is hiring for a software engineering specialist. To join our growing team, please review the list of responsibilities and qualifications.
Responsibilities for software engineering specialist
  • You will be responsible to implement quality UI practices at all stages of the application development life cycle and implement site development plan / standards
  • You will design and build a completely new product from scratch based on cutting edge technologies and architecture
  • You will influence and contribute in all phases of the development lifecycle from ideation to development and execution
  • You will be part of a strong team taking our product to its next generation
  • Extracting raw data from various databases
  • Generating and maintaining reports, in different formats e
  • Participating or leading improvement projects and initiatives
  • Identifying improvement opportunities and leading the projects to implement
  • Testing internally developed tools and providing adequate feedback
  • Software engineering process ownership
Qualifications for software engineering specialist
  • Must be willing to work out of an office located in Lisle & Chicago, IL
  • Must be willing to relocate to Chicago, IL
  • Build management and tooling
  • Can analyze issues in the application and locate the problem
  • Writes clear, concise, efficient codes and program structure
  • Can read, interpret and analyze joblogs

Related Job Descriptions

Resume Builder

Create a Resume in Minutes with Professional Resume Templates